[Linux] Menu hotkeys only work after opening the menu at least once
To reproduce:
1) Create new project
2) Select any object
3) Try Shift+Alt+A
Expected: Object gets enabled/disabled
Actual: Nothing happens.
Workaround: Open GameObject menu in top menu bar and close it. Now the hotkeys work until you switch scenes/close and reopen editor/other actions
Reproduced in 2017.4.9f1, 2018.2.10f1
Not reproduced in Windows 10
